Photographs of Perth, Western Australia Home | Locality A-Z | Notes Harvey A growing town between Yarloop and Brunswick - dairying and fruit growing region - situated 140 kms south of Perth on the South Western Highway |

Harvey - Church One of Harvey's churches. This church was dedicated and opened by the Rev. Dr Clune, Archbishop of Perth, on Sunday 20th November 1932. December 2010 |

Harvey - Station Most of the train stations have undergone a metamorphosis over the years on this line. Thankfully the old Harvey Station has been preserved, unlike some which have disappeared altogether. The boarding/alighting point for the Australind train is the small green-fenced area to the right of picture. December 2010 |
